One more thing I should add and maybe someone like Mark Yacavone who knows vastly more than I ever will about 200’s could comment on this:
You need to let your converter builder know it’s going in front of a 200 with a 350 pump conversion.
Something to do with direction of oil flow and excessive pressure build up in the converter. I heard this from Coan.
Thanks Bill, It most likely has to do with using the support bushing ,either inside the pilot, or in the stator support. I don't build 350 conversion transmissions. I just build straight 200 converters to go with my trans's.
My new 305 converter will be for straight 200s, at first,which I think will be the most popular.
Again, Leo also builds the 350 conversions ,as does Jack Sepanik and a few others.
